If now Kate is three times as old as Jan, and 6 years ago she was six times as old as he was, how old are they now?
Lady_Fox [76]

Answer:

<h2>Jan is 10 years old.</h2><h2>Kate is 30 years old.</h2>

Step-by-step explanation:

To solve this problem, we need to find a system of equations.

<h3>Now: Kate is three times as old as Jan.</h3>

This statement can be expressed as K=3J, beacuse "three times" indicates a product.

<h3>6 years ago: She was six times as old as he was.</h3>

This statement can be expressed as K-6=6(J-6), notice that we had to subtract 6 units, representing 6 years in the past.

Let's replace the first equation into the second one

3J-6=6(J-6)\\3J-6=6J-36\\-6+36=6J-3J\\3J=30\\J=\frac{30}{3}\\ J=10

Therefore, Jan is 10 years old.

Then, K=3J \implies K=3(10)=30

Therefore, Kate is 30 years old.
